The fact that men and women are not the same is no longer completely 
overlooked in the medical world. Diseases, such as heart attacks, can 
present differently. Yet, an absence of research that includes women prior 
to the early 1990s has left studies into women’s health largely in “catch-up” 
mode. Our guest is Judy Regensteiner, PhD, director and co-founder of the 
Ludeman Family Center for Women’s Health Research at the University of 
Colorado Anschutz Medical Campus. The center has become a national 
leader in conducting research across the span of women’s lives, especially 
in the areas of cardiovascular disease, diabetes and mental health.
